Visual analytics is an indispensable tool for data science professionals as it unravels complex data into understandable narratives. One such visualization technique that stands out in its ability to represent the flow and relationships within a dataset is the Sankey chart. This article delves into the nuances and power of Sankey charts, explaining how they can be used to maximize data insights and reveal the perfection within systems.
Understanding Sankey Charts
Sankey charts, originally developed in 1898 by the engineer and physicist John Sankey, offer a unique way to visualize the flow of energy, materials, and information across various processes or systems. They are renowned for their ability to capture the idea that energy or material flow can be transformed from one form to another in a non-linear manner.
At its core, a Sankey chart consists of horizontal streams or ‘flows’ that represent variables (such as energy or goods) being transported. These flows branch off from a shared ‘root’ at the left or bottom of the chart and terminate in a common ‘sink’ at the right or top. The width of each flow represents the volume or amount of the material or energy it depicts. As flows interact, the width diminishes to show that some material or energy is used or transformed into other forms.
The Advantages of Sankey Charts in Data Analysis
1. **Clarity and Simplicity**: Sankey charts distill complex data into intuitive, flow-based graphs. They convey a vast amount of information in an effortlessly understandable format.
2. **Highlighting Losses and Efficiencies**: These charts naturally illustrate inefficiencies, losses, and bottlenecks. Their wide-to-narrow construction highlights areas where energy or materials are lost in quantity or quality.
3. **Flow and Cycle Time Analysis**: Sankey charts can effectively map the flow of information, goods, or services over time, which helps in analyzing cycle times and understanding the performance of business processes.
4. **Comparative Insight**: With the ability to represent and compare different systems or components, Sankey charts offer a benchmark for performance or efficiency and can help determine best practices.
The Process of Utilizing Sankey Charts
Creating effective Sankey charts involves several stages:
1. **Data Identification**: Identify the variables that will be represented by the flows in your Sankey chart. This could be energy, materials, or information, depending on the context.
2. **Data Collection**: Collect the data that will support the flows you wish to display. This might require aggregation and summing up relevant metrics.
3. **Flow Mapping**: Decide on the direction and sequence of the data flow within your system and represent this with the chart’s stream design. It is essential to choose an order that makes sense for the narrative you wish to tell.
4. **Design and Formatting**: Create a Sankey chart with the aid of various charting tools that support this specific visualization, such as Tableau, D3.js, Python’s Plotly, or dedicated Sankey chart software.
5. **Analysis and Interpretation**: Once the chart is created, analyze it to identify any patterns, anomalies, or inefficiencies. Use this analysis to inform strategies for optimization or further data exploration.
Case Studies: Applying the Sankey Visualization Technique
Let’s consider a few examples of Sankey charts in practice:
– **Energy Efficiency**: Sankey charts are frequently used in the energy industry. They can map the flow of energy from fossil fuels to end-use devices, highlighting losses and inefficiencies in the energy generation, distribution, and consumption cycle.
– **E-commerce Operations**: By tracking the flow of items across a supply chain, Sankey charts can expose bottlenecks in the processing pipeline, enabling e-commerce companies to optimize their order fulfillment processes.
– **Environmental Studies**: For sustainability research, Sankey charts can capture the flows of greenhouse gases or other pollutants, illustrating their journey through an ecosystem and the steps that might reduce their impact.
Maximizing Insights with Sankey Charts
To unlock the full potential of Sankey charts, data scientists and analysts must consider the following:
– **Contextual Narrative**: Tailor the chart to complement the context in which it will be used, ensuring that the story conveyed is relevant to the audience.
– **Storytelling**: Use storytelling techniques when presenting the charts. Highlighting key insights and connections will engage the audience and facilitate a deeper understanding of the data.
– **Interactivity**: Incorporate interactive elements to allow end-users to explore the data, manipulate different variables, and refine their analysis.
In conclusion, Sankey charts are more than just visual tools; they are powerful narratives weaving through a fabric of complex data to reveal the subtle tapestries of cause and effect. By maximizing their use and interpreting their inscriptions, we can uncover the power and perfection within the systems we seek to understand.